Glutarimide
Based on 1 Customer Validation
Glutarimide is a CRBN binder. Glutarimide exerts its function by binding to the thalidomide-binding domain of the CRBN protein. Glutarimide serves as an important structural component of many biologically active compounds. Glutarimide can be used in studies related to anemia, multiple myeloma and cycloheximide.

Biological Activity
|
Cereblon |
Glutarimide is the CRBN-binding motif that mediates the interaction between CELMoD and the thalidomide-binding domain of CRBN[1].
Glutarimide does not inhibit carbachol (HY-B1208)-induced calcium mobilization in neuroblastoma SK-N-SH cells at concentrations up to 120 μM, with an IC50 > 120 μM[2].
